Peninsula Pain Clinic is looking for a highly organized and detail-oriented Procedure Coordinator to join our team. In this key role youll be the hub that keeps our procedure schedule running smoothly - supporting patients, providers, and clinical staff every step of the way.
Key Responsibilities:
- Coordinate and schedule patient procedures from start to finish
- Obtain and manage prior authorizations, including submitting documentation and insurance follow-up
- Communicate clearly and compassionately with patients and insurance carriers
- Gather and review required medical records and documentation
- Confirm procedure dates, times, and readiness with patients
- Review pre-procedure instructions to ensure patients feel prepared
- Ensure all requirements are completed prior to procedure day
- Maintain accurate documentation in the electronic medical record (EMR)
- Partner with providers and clinical staff to support efficient workflow
Qualifications:
- High school diploma or equivalent; additional healthcare education a plus
- Experience in a medical office, surgical scheduling, or prior authorization role preferred
- Strong understanding of insurance verification and authorization processes
- Excellent organizational and time-management skills
- Friendly, professional communication and customer service skills
- Ability to multitask and prioritize in a busy clinic environment
- Comfortable working in EMR systems and standard office software
